Home School Agreement

In Rosecroft Primary School we encourage staff, the children and their family to work together to ensure good behaviour, clear expectations and positive relationships by following our Home School Agreement. See below for more details.

The school will

  • Provide a safe happy learning environment.
  • Encourage children to do their best at all times.
  • Encourage good behaviour and respect for others.
  • Inform you of your child’s progress, at meetings and by written reports.
  • Inform you about what your children will learn every two weeks.
  • Contact you promptly if there are concerns about your child’s health, wellbeing or attendance.

Listen to any concerns you may have and follow up any actions required as soon as possible.

The family will

  • Make sure your child arrives at school on time.
  • Make sure your child attends school regularly and provide an explanation for your child’s absence as soon as it occurs.
  • Ensure your child is suitably dressed and equipped for all school activities, with all property named.
  • Attend parent – teacher meetings.
  • Support the School’s behaviour policies by
  • Not allowing your child to bring toys to school except by special arrangement.
  • Making sure that bikes, scooters and other wheeled items are not used in the school grounds.
  • Supervising your child in the playground before and after school.
  • Supplying only water in drinking bottles used in the classroom.
  • Support your child’s learning by reading regularly and helping them with other home learning activities.
